Sunday 28 February 2016

Malloc swap function program

/*swapping two values through malloc function C program*/
struct stud
 char nam[30];
 struct stud *next;
struct stud *p,*q;
int main()
 p=(struct stud *)malloc(sizeof(struct stud));
 q=(struct stud *)malloc(sizeof(struct stud));
 printf("Enter name p : ");
 printf("Enter name q : ");
 printf("\nName of p : %s",p->next->nam);
 printf("\nName of q : %s",q->next->nam);
 return 0;


Enter name p : Peter
Enter name q : Jhon

Name of p : Jhon

Name of q : Peter

No comments:

Post a Comment

Ads Inside Post